123ArticleOnline Logo
Welcome to 123ArticleOnline.com!
ALL >> Web-Design >> View Article

Angular Vs React : Comparing Differences

Profile Picture
By Author: Jeevan
Total Articles: 4
Comment this article
Facebook ShareTwitter ShareGoogle+ ShareTwitter Share

Picking upon Angular & React services for your site can be amazing nowadays as both remain as prominent JavaScript systems. Angular and React are widely used JavaScript (JS) technologies that are utilized to make intuitive single-page applications (SPAs). We have recorded couple of brisk focuses beneath that makes Angular and React emerge out in their own way.


Technology Angular React
Type MVC framework written in JavaScript JavaScript Library that has view in MVC, however requires flux to implement architecture
Concept/ Process Works by bringing JavaScript into HTML with the real DOM client-side rendering Works by bringing HTML into JavaScript with virtual DOM server-side rendering
Data Binding Two-way data binding One-way data binding
Dependencies Manages dependencies automatically Requires additional tools to manage dependencies
Best suited Best for SPA’s that update single view at a time Best for SPA’s that update many views at a time


We have additionally talked about their individual contrasts as for componentization, performance, data binding, directives, ...
... and templates.

Componentization

Angular has a fixed structure and it depends on the three layers that are Model, View, and Controller. The Model is introduced by the controller, which is then changed into HTML to make View for the clients.

React is made with an alternate design that is particular from Angular yet like MVC structures. There is no particular structure for React. React is a tremendous JavaScript library that refreshes the perspectives for the clients, the structure needs model and controller layers, anyway Facebook presented Flux that has better control on the application work process

Performance

The standout in Angular's execution is the element of two-way data binding though React uses a virtual Document Object Model, which is considered as leverage of React in correlation with different structures including Angular. However, the performance of an application may fluctuate depending upon the memory of the application and code enhancement.

Data Binding

The Data binding idea is considered as significant distinction among Angular and React. Angular web development utilizes Two-way data binding which implies that any adjustment in the UI field would likewise change the data in the model progressively. In the event of React web development, it utilizes one-way data binding, where the data in the application streams in a single direction. Angular is productive as engineers think that its simple to work with while React is more towards the structural representation, understandability in light of the fact that the data streams in a singale direction.

Directives and Templates

Angular directives are utilized to sort out the code around DOM. Designers can get access to the directives just through DOM. Designers can likewise make their very own directives other than the standard directives (ng-bind, ng-app) that are available.

React does not distinguish between directives & templates,template logic ought to be written in the template itself. This methodology of template and logic being set in one spot is better as we would invest lesser time in understanding.

Conclusion :

Angular and React are distinctive instruments that work extraordinary for single-page applications in their individual ways. A few designers may lean toward Angular in consideration to the reasons to choose Angular and some may incline toward React. Anyway the choice would be with respect to project requirements.

Total Views: 298Word Count: 521See All articles From Author

Add Comment

Web Design Articles

1. Dark Mode, Light Speed: Modern Ux Trends In Web Development
Author: Suganya, Digital Marketing Intern.

2. Seo Service On A Low Budget With Brightara Media
Author: Brightara Media

3. New Technologies Booming In Mobile App Development
Author: Levontehcno

4. The Top Benefits Of Partnering With A Good Seo Company
Author: Liam Mackie

5. Why Choosing The Right Software Development Company In Delhi Can Boost Your Business
Author: Vikki kumar

6. Why Enseur Is A Top Event Management App For Modern Planners
Author: Enseur Tech

7. Customizable Web-based Erp Software In Noida Designed For Schools And Colleges
Author: CONTENT EDITOR FOR SAMPHIRE IT SOLUTIONS PVT LTD

8. How Custom Websites Drive Smarter Lead Generation And Crm Efficiency
Author: Wise Code Studio

9. Advanced Mobile Tracking Sg | Attendance 1 Sgd Monthly
Author: chinni jyothi

10. Employee Attendance Sg | Biometric Scanner 1 Sgd Per Month
Author: chinni jyothi

11. Top Seo Services In Delhi For Business Growth
Author: ayraphics

12. Advantages And Disadvantages Of A Static Website
Author: Manoj Singh

13. Top Dental Website Design Trends In 2025: What Your Clinic Needs To Stand Out Online
Author: PSM

14. How Can The Ecommerce Website Design Make Or Break Your Online Business?
Author: Liam Mackie

15. Best Practices To Boost Your Health & Wellness Products Selling Online
Author: Miten Shah

Login To Account
Login Email:
Password:
Forgot Password?
New User?
Sign Up Newsletter
Email Address: